This is a ranking of the highest-grossing Bangladeshi films screened at cinemas in Bangladesh and globally. Films generate income from several revenue streams, including box office sales (admissions), theatrical exhibition, television broadcast rights, and music album sales. There is no official tracking of sales and online sources publishing ...

Bangladesh Television was the first television station in the region of South Asia to commence full-time color broadcasts in December 1980, followed by Pakistan Television of Pakistan and Doordarshan of India in 1982. As Bangladesh Television was the only television channel available in the country at the time, its viewership and popularity soared.
